West Ham were once forced to replay a League Cup match for fielding an ineligible player – unlike Grimsby Town, who were given a reprieve for a similar offence against Manchester United .

Ruben Amorim's side were humiliatingly dumped out of the Carabao Cup by the League Two club, who triumphed 12-11 on penalties after United had salvaged a 2-2 draw. It was subsequently revealed that Clarke Oduor, who came on as a 73rd-minute substitute and missed a penalty in the shootout, was technically not eligible for the second round tie.

A loan signing from Bradford City, the Kenyan's registration was submitted at 12.01pm on the day prior to the match, just after the 12pm deadline. The Mariners have been fined £20,000 by the EFL, with half of it suspended until the end of the season.
